Why E-Waste Is Bad for the Planet

While technological advancements improve our daily lives, electronic waste presents considerable environmental hazards. Disposed electronic equipment, frequently composed of toxic substances including lead, mercury, and cadmium, can leach toxins into soil and groundwater, creating hazards for human health and ecosystems. The accelerating rate of technological innovation leads to higher rates of electronics disposal among consumers, intensifying the growing problem of discarded electronic materials.

Landfills, already burdened with waste, struggle to accommodate the growing volumes of discarded gadgets. Incineration, another disposal method, releases harmful pollutants into the atmosphere, contributing to air quality degradation. In addition, improper recycling practices can lead to the exportation of e-waste to developing countries, where laborers may dismantle devices without adequate safety measures, exposing themselves to dangerous substances. This pattern of negligence and mismanagement highlights the critical demand for eco-friendly recycling alternatives that can reduce the damaging impact of electronic waste on the environment.

How E-Waste Recycling Works

The recycling of e-waste encompasses a systematic process intended to extract beneficial components while limiting ecological damage. At the outset, discarded electronics are retrieved and sent to dedicated processing centers. Upon arrival, the equipment is meticulously organized to distinguish harmful elements from reusable resources.

Following this, workers break down the electronics, recovering plastics, metals, and glass. This step is critical, as it facilitates the recovery of high-value metals like silver, gold, and copper, which are repurposed in new electronics.

Subsequently, the sorted materials are processed via sophisticated techniques, such as mechanical shredding and chemical processing, to purify them for recycling.

Finally, the leftover hazardous waste is handled with responsibility, following environmental guidelines. This systematic method not only preserves valuable resources but also mitigates the risks associated with unsafe e-waste handling, securing a more eco-conscious future for electronic consumption.

How to Choose an E-Waste Recycling Service

Choosing the most suitable e-waste recycling service is essential for making sure that electronic refuse is processed in a responsible and sustainable manner. First, individuals should confirm the provider's accreditations, such as e-Stewards or R2, which indicate adherence to industry standards for secure waste disposal procedures. It's also important to evaluate the company's credibility by checking reviews and obtaining advice from dependable sources.

Next, openness in the recycling process is crucial. A trustworthy service should provide clear information about the way e-waste is handled and what becomes of the materials. Additionally, assessing the variety of services available can be advantageous; certain providers may offer collection services or present rewards for recycling.

Finally, familiarizing yourself with area-specific requirements for e-waste disposal can further guide the decision-making process. Through focusing on these key aspects, people are able to support responsible e-waste disposal as well as promoting green and responsible behaviors.

Questions We Often Receive

What Kinds of Electronics Can Be Recycled?

Many different electronics can be recycled, including computers, smartphones, televisions, laptops, gaming consoles, and printers. Moreover, peripherals such as batteries, keyboards, and mice are well-suited for recycling, supporting sustainable environmental practices.

Is There a Cost Associated With E-Waste Recycling?

Yes, e-waste disposal can include costs, depending on the service provider. Certain providers charge fees for gathering or treatment, while some providers offer free services, often subsidized by the resale of recovered materials.

What Are the Benefits of E-Waste Recycling for Businesses?

Businesses can benefit from e-waste recycling by reducing disposal costs, strengthening their ecological standing, adhering to regulatory requirements, extracting valuable resources, and potentially generating revenue through resale, thus supporting a greener and more sustainable operational framework.

What Happens to Data on Recycled Devices?

Data from repurposed equipment is frequently irretrievably wiped or destroyed during the refurbishment process. This guarantees sensitive information stays protected, preventing unauthorized access while permitting components to be recycled safely and responsibly across new manufacturing processes.

Can I Recycle Broken Electronics?

Absolutely, non-functioning electronics can be recycled. Several collection points receive broken devices, providing responsible disposal and extraction of valuable materials. It helps reduce the environmental footprint while promoting eco-friendly recycling methods to control electrical waste responsibly.
